'><span>Next, we need to get rid of the extra unwanted foreground pixels. I'll use a method that the mathematical morphology folks call <\/span><a href = \"https:\/\/blogs.mathworks.com\/steve\/2008\/07\/14\/opening-by-reconstruction\/\"><span style=' font-style: italic;'>opening by reconstruction<\/span><\/a><span>. The first step is to erode the image in a way that eliminates all the unwanted pixels, while maintaining at least a portion of all the objects we want to keep. An erosion by a vertical line will get rid of the thin horizontal lines, and an erosion by a horizontal line will get rid of the thin vertical lines.<\/span><\/div><div style=\"background-color: #F5F5F5; margin: 10px 0 10px 0;\"><div class=\"inlineWrapper\"><div  style = 'border-left: 1px solid rgb(191, 191, 191); border-right: 1px solid rgb(191, 191, 191); border-top: 1px solid rgb(191, 191, 191); border-bottom: 0px none rgb(33, 33, 33); border-radius: 4px 4px 0px 0px; padding: 6px 45px 0px 13px; line-height: 18.004px; min-height: 0px; white-space: nowrap; color: rgb(33, 33, 33); font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; '><span style=\"white-space: pre\"><span >mask2 = imerode(mask,ones(21,1));<\/span><\/span><\/div><\/div><div class=\"inlineWrapper outputs\"><div  style = 'border-left: 1px solid rgb(191, 191, 191); border-right: 1px solid rgb(191, 191, 191); border-top: 0px none rgb(33, 33, 33); border-bottom: 1px solid rgb(191, 191, 191); border-radius: 0px; padding: 0px 45px 4px 13px; line-height: 18.004px; min-height: 0px; white-space: nowrap; color: rgb(33, 33, 33); font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; '><span style=\"white-space: pre\"><span >imshow(mask2)<\/span><\/span><\/div><div  style = 'color: rgb(33, 33, 33); padding: 10px 0px 6px 17px; background: rgb(255, 255, 255) none repeat scroll 0% 0% \/ auto padding-box border-box; font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; overflow-x: hidden; line-height: 17.234px; '><div class=\"inlineElement eoOutputWrapper embeddedOutputsFigure\" uid=\"AD84D250\" prevent-scroll=\"true\" data-testid=\"output_1\" style=\"width: 1145px;\"><div class=\"figureElement eoOutputContent\"><img decoding=\"async\" class=\"figureImage figureContainingNode\" src=\"https:\/\/blogs.mathworks.com\/steve\/files\/cheese_puzzle_polyshape_5.png\" style=\"width: 974px; padding-bottom: 0px;\"><\/div><div class=\"outputLayer selectedOutputDecorationLayer doNotExport\"><\/div><div class=\"outputLayer activeOutputDecorationLayer doNotExport\"><\/div><div class=\"outputLayer scrollableOutputDecorationLayer doNotExport\"><\/div><\/div><\/div><\/div><\/div><div style=\"background-color: #F5F5F5; margin: 10px 0 10px 0;\"><div class=\"inlineWrapper\"><div  style = 'border-left: 1px solid rgb(191, 191, 191); border-right: 1px solid rgb(191, 191, 191); border-top: 1px solid rgb(191, 191, 191); border-bottom: 0px none rgb(33, 33, 33); border-radius: 4px 4px 0px 0px; padding: 6px 45px 0px 13px; line-height: 18.004px; min-height: 0px; white-space: nowrap; color: rgb(33, 33, 33); font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; '><span style=\"white-space: pre\"><span >mask3 = imerode(mask2,ones(1,21));<\/span><\/span><\/div><\/div><div class=\"inlineWrapper outputs\"><div  style = 'border-left: 1px solid rgb(191, 191, 191); border-right: 1px solid rgb(191, 191, 191); border-top: 0px none rgb(33, 33, 33); border-bottom: 1px solid rgb(191, 191, 191); border-radius: 0px; padding: 0px 45px 4px 13px; line-height: 18.004px; min-height: 0px; white-space: nowrap; color: rgb(33, 33, 33); font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; '><span style=\"white-space: pre\"><span >imshow(mask3)<\/span><\/span><\/div><div  style = 'color: rgb(33, 33, 33); padding: 10px 0px 6px 17px; background: rgb(255, 255, 255) none repeat scroll 0% 0% \/ auto padding-box border-box; font-family: Menlo, Monaco, Consolas, \"Courier New\", monospace; font-size: 14px; overflow-x: hidden; line-height: 17.234px; '><div class=\"inlineElement eoOutputWrapper embeddedOutputsFigure\" uid=\"412BCF47\" prevent-scroll=\"true\" data-testid=\"output_2\" style=\"width: 1145px;\"><div class=\"figureElement eoOutputContent\"><img decoding=\"async\" class=\"figureImage figureContainingNode\" src=\"https:\/\/blogs.mathworks.com\/steve\/files\/cheese_puzzle_polyshape_6.png\" style=\"width: 974px; padding-bottom: 0px;\"><\/div><div class=\"outputLayer selectedOutputDecorationLayer doNotExport\"><\/div><div class=\"outputLayer activeOutputDecorationLayer doNotExport\"><\/div><div class=\"outputLayer scrollableOutputDecorationLayer doNotExport\"><\/div><\/div><\/div><\/div><\/div><div  style = 'margin: 2px 10px 9px 4px; padding: 0px; line-height: 21px; min-height: 0px; white-space: pre-wrap; color: rgb(33, 33, 33); font-family: Helvetica, Arial, sans-serif; font-style: normal; font-size: 14px; font-weight: 400; text-align: left; '><span>In the image above, the extraneous foreground pixels are gone, but the puzzle pieces have been shrunk. Now, how do we turn these puzzle pieces into some kind of easily plottable representations? Cleve had suggested patch objects, but it is complicated to create patch objects containing holes. I suggested using <\/span><span style=' font-family: monospace;'>polyshape<\/span><span> instead. A <\/span><span style=' font-family: monospace;'>polyshape<\/span><span> is an object that can represent shapes that are composed of polygons. You can create a <\/span><span style=' font-family: monospace;'>polyshape<\/span><span> from a collection of polygons that bound individual regions and holes, and the Image Processing Toolbox function <\/span><span style=' font-family: monospace;'>bwboundaries<\/span><span> can produce just such a list of polygons.<\/span><\/div><div style=\"background-color: #F5F5F5; In my image processing work, I often see this warning message from polyshape. Usually it is because I'm passing a bunch of colinear vertices to polyshape. They are colinear because the vertices are on the image pixel grid. I generally ignore the warning.<\/span><\/div><div  style = 'margin: 2px 10px 9px 4px; padding: 0px; line-height: 21px; min-height: 0px; white-space: pre-wrap; color: rgb(33, 33, 33); font-family: Helvetica, Arial, sans-serif; font-style: normal; font-size: 14px; font-weight: 400; text-align: left; '><span>There's another issue, though. Why does the output of polyshape say it has 6 regions instead of 5? I had to search a bit for the reason. We can see it by zooming into one of the corners of the lower right puzzle piece and superimposing the boundary traced by bwboundaries.<\/span><\/div><div style=\"background-color: #F5F5F5; margin: 10px 0 10px 0;\"><div class=\"inlineWrapper\"><div  style = 'border-left: 1px solid rgb(191, 191, 191); '><span>There's a spot where the traced boundary is self-intersecting, and that causes <\/span><span style=' font-family: monospace;'>polyshape<\/span><span> to treat that tiny triangle at the bottom as a separate region. We can do a little area-based processing of the <\/span><span style=' font-family: monospace;'>polyshape<\/span><span> to get rid of that triangle.<\/span><\/div><div  style = 'margin: 2px 10px 9px 4px;
